Radio Classique Quebec is an online radio station that offers a unique blend of classical music and cultural programming. With its captivating and sophisticated content, this station aims to bring the joy and elegance of classical music to listeners in Quebec, Canada, and beyond.

The website radioclassique.ca serves as the digital platform for Radio Classique Quebec, providing a seamless and immersive experience for music lovers. Upon visiting the website, listeners are greeted with a sleek and modern design that reflects the station's commitment to quality and professionalism.

One aspect that sets Radio Classique Quebec apart is its dedication to promoting Canadian talent, particularly in the classical music industry. The station regularly showcases performances by local musicians, composers, and ensembles, providing a platform for their work to reach a broader audience.

In addition to the exceptional musical content, Radio Classique Quebec also offers engaging cultural programming that delves into various art forms and historical periods. These shows provide listeners with a deeper understanding and appreciation of classical music, allowing them to discover new facets of this timeless genre.
